eLearning Australia partnership with USC
18-May-2011Online learning company, eLearning Australia, are teaming up with the University of the Sunshine Coast to create and develop a leading resource in online training materials.
eLearning Australia will have a number of computer-based design students assist them in producing a software program that will have language, literacy and numeracy skills integrated into a construction industry context.
Graham Rodgers, the company director of eLearning Australia, said he intends to encourage creative input from the skilled students assisting him on the project, and allow them to stretch the boundaries of what can be done.
The project became even more exciting after the valuable input from Uwe Terton, a lecturer in computer based design, who recognised the great opportunity for his students. “The project is an educational one and I believe that the future of educational computer based applications is rosy,” Uwe said, “Being part of such a project will give my students a head start when they dive into their professional life."
